With work based on an analysis of a particular corpus of linguistic material, V.M.Leichik was the first to propose a classification of terminological variation (1982:21). Using this system of classification, Russian and Kazakh epizoological terms can be divided into variants based on their material differences:
1. Doublets. For example: epizoology/epidemiology. Сапролегниоз -дерматомикоз
(saprolegniosis /dermatomycosis) - a disease found in fish characterised by lesions to the fins or gills. Пневмония - вирусный аборт кобыл (Pneumonia/equine miscarriage virus) - a disease found in mares, characterised by fever leading to unexpected
miscarriages. Колибактериоз - эпирихиоз (colibacillosis) - a disease characterised by serious poisoning and dehydration. Стрептокоз - диплоккоз (streptocosis/diplocosis) - a disease found in young animals characterised by septicaemia and inflammation of the joints. Орнитоз - пситтакоз (ornithosis/psittacosis) - respiratory disease characterised by lesions to the mucous membranes of the respiratory passages.
2. Conceptual synonyms within a single terminological system. Eg:
финноз/цистициркоз/ценуроз (measles/cysticercosis/coenurosis).
3. Collocations and complex words. Within Russian and Kazakh zoonotic
synonymy, the incidence of eponyms (designation based on the surname of a doctor or academic) is particularly widespread. For example: Whitmore's disease (named after the English doctor who discovered this rare disease); fibromatosis in rabbits Shope's fibroma (American academic, 1932); leptospirosis - Weil-Vasilev's
disease (German and Russian academics, 1888 and 1886); African swine fever - Montgomery's disease (1991); pseudorabies - Aujeszky's disease (Hungarian
academic 1902). And in Kazakh: Whitmore's disease - Whitmore aurury; Shope's fibroma -Shope fibromasy; Weil-Vasilev's disease - Weil-Vasilev aurury: Montgomery's disease: Montgomery aurury; Aujeszky's disease -Aujeszky aurury.
4. Double collocation. This group is made up of eponymous synonyms, based on
the geographical location where the disease was identified. For
example: rickettsial fever - Marseille fever (Marseille, France); Rocky mountain
spotted fever (America), Japanese river fever. In Kazakh: Marsel bezgegi, Zhapon ozen bezgegi. Also: viral plasmacytosis - Aleutian mink disease. In Kazakh: Norka Aluet aurury: viral hepatitis - Rift Valley fever (Rift Valley, Kenya); paramyxovirus - Newcastle disease (Newcastle, UK); tularaemia - O'Hara's disease.
5. Interstructural. These occur in various combinations of full and shortened
terminological variance, including combinations of collocation and abbreviation. In Russian and Kazakh, complex, multi-element collocations are examples of phraseological terms (A.V.Superanski). They consist of material from the indigenous language combined with borrowings. The existence of phraseological terms suggests a desire for accuracy. Phraseological terms enable specific characteristics to be attributed to diseases, such as its degree of severity and other particularities. As Russian and Kazakh use composite analytical designations, a greater level of descriptive detail is possible. In turn, this allows a more explicit description of elements observed more widely in the natural world. Abbreviations are used to enable these detailed designations to be used operationally. The most common types are letter-based abbreviations. Letter-based initialisms (abbreviations proper) are particularly widespread in zoonotic terminologies: PVL (Povalnoe Vospalenie Legkikh) - general inflammation of the lungs; ZKT (Zlokachestvennaia Kataralnaia Goriachka) - malignant catarrhal fever; AChS (Afrikanskaia Chuma Svienei) - African swine fever; VGES (Virusniy
Gastroenterit Svinei) - Viral Gastroenteritis in pigs; KPP (Kontagioznaia plevropnevmonia) - contagious pleuropneumonia.
6. Stylistic. These occur as stylistic synonymy. One of each pair of synonyms
belongs to a separate terminological system. Eg: Epilepsy -petit mal.
Within linguistics, opinions on the issue of variation in specialised units of language
have undergone a paradigm shift. The change from structural to structural-functional research methods have allowed terms to be open to a larger number of new ideas and key concepts. As a result, formal and semantic variation has now become one of the fundamental characteristics of terms themselves. Through having undergone the intellectual processes involved in research and analysis by academics, terms become a universal linguistic concept, the essence of which is their general characteristic as a linguistic sign. It Is sometimes argued that linguistic research into variation leads logically to a related set of issues focused on the various aspects of terms and their semantic variation.

In the typology of dictionaries proposed by L.V.Scherba, terminological dictionaries
are not included. As an academic discipline, with its own theoretical propositions, principles and methods, terminography started to develop in the 1970s and 80s, when generalised theories began to emerge in the works of Rondeau, Berkov, Marchuk, Grinev and others. It must be noted that future challenges for Kazakh lexicography include the publication of fundamental research on the theoretical issues associated with bilingual lexicography and terminography (including the Russian/Kazakh language pair). Sh.Sh.Saribaeva believes that: 'statistics show that only around ten of the 500 doctoral theses presented over the last fifty years have focused on the theory of lexicography. This bears witness to how much theory is lagging behind practice at present.' (Saribaev, 2001:11). V.M.Leichik notes that the gap between theory and practice has led to a situation where most terminological dictionaries have been written on intuition. Zh.N.Zhunusovaia's monograph notes: 'Kazakh lexicographers have a huge task ahead of them, including a bilingual dictionary of equivalences, a dictionary of syntactic constructions, an ideographic dictionary and a bilingual phraseological dictionary. There are still no published phraseological thesauruses, biographical dictionaries of Kazakh writers or dictionaries of spoken language. The time has also come for glossaries which chronicle individual authors' use of language, dictionaries of set phrases in Kazakh,
bilingual terminological dictionaries and much besides. The need for translators to work on full-scale bilingual dictionaries of various kinds has now become pressing (Zhunusova, 2001:56).
Looking at material from the world of epizoological terminology, there are a
number of lexicographical dichotomies, which have a direct bearing on the research and publication of bilingual terminological dictionaries. The normative/descriptive dichotomy plays an important role in how the compilation of Russian-Kazakh dictionaries of epizoological terms could be approached. The author's position is that a Russian-Kazakh dictionary of epizoological terms should allow for the inclusion of aspects of both ends of the dichotomy, and that this approach does not contradict the principles of terminological dictionary compilation. Specialists have noted that, within the Kazakh system of epizoological terminology, there has long been a lack of Kazakh equivalent epizoological terms, which could express relevant scientific concepts. (Kazakh equivalents of those terms are either rarely used or have been forgotten altogether).
The World Health Organisation adopted Latin as the base language of epizoological
terminology. As a result, Latin-based words predominate. And although a large number of doublet terms do exist, Kazakh-rooted terms tend to have been displaced by those of Latin and Russian origin. Dictionaries of epizoological terminology have tended to take a prescriptive and normative approach. Within the world of veterinary medicine, it is therefore possible that Turkic words, taken from Kazakh lexical and semantic linguistic systems, will start to be used in parallel with terminological sets that are already in use. Notes on usage could provide recommendations on the appropriateness or otherwise of using one epizoological term over another in veterinary medical practice. The definition of each term could include remarks describing the norms associated with it. The arguments laid out here should indicate that prescriptive and normative approaches play a defining role in the establishment, normalisation and standardisation of an epizoological terminology, as well as its adoption by specialists, practitioners in the field and ordinary citizens. It could lead to richer variation in the theory and practice of medical and veterinary medicine. It might also lead to an improvement in accessibility for ordinary people in terms of public health warnings, recommendations and advertising. However, it must be noted that the renewal of this area of language is particularly challenging, due to the conservative nature of its vocabulary. This remains a barrier to its comprehensibility.
The dichotomy of detail versus brevity is one of the more difficult phenomena to
address in compiling a dictionary. Three types of dictionaries are relevant to the detail/brevity discussion: the complete, or unabridged dictionary, which presents the historical development of a language; the mid-scale dictionary, which aims to present the diachronic variety of a language
75
in its contemporary form; and the abridged, or popular dictionary, which includes descriptions of normative aspects of contemporary written discourse. Unabridged dictionaries are designed for specialists, although those outside linguistics do also use them. The mid-scale dictionary has the same purpose as its full-scale counterpart. Abridged dictionaries will not provide specialists with the full range of material they need, but can be used by non-specialists. L.V.Scherba described all three types of dictionary as: 'a unified (and genuine) linguistic record of a particular section of humanity at a particular moment in time.' (1974:74, 140).
Turning back to epizoological terminology and veterinary medicine, the author
believes that the compilation of a specialised dictionary could overcome the challenges of the detail/brevity dichotomy by purely technical means: these could include changes in the font and typeface size, introductory remarks at the beginning of articles on individual terms and cross-referencing to other articles. The type and nature of the sources likely to be quoted suggests this would be best presented in an unabridged dictionary. The maximum number of epizoological terms would need to be included, as the aim would be to introduce the new terminological group into practical usage.
The dichotomy between definition and ideography is no less important in the
compilation of a dictionary of epizoological terms. This dichotomy is concerned with satisfying the needs of the end user. Users of such a dictionary could include epizoological researchers, practising veterinary surgeons, or ordinary members of the public, who may have come up against a veterinary problem in their own life. Focussing on the end user could be an opportunity to move away from a single principle in presenting the definitions of words, and to attempt to structure the work as a multi-purpose dictionary, including two types of definition: one based on words and the other on graphics, in the style of an encyclopaedia.
Encyclopaedia-style dictionaries are an effective means of improving the
professional skills and competences of specialists in any discipline. The educational opportunities presented by these types of dictionary have resulted in a continuing rise in the number of subject-specific encyclopaedia-style dictionaries being published. In effect, they are semantic dictionaries of specialised terminologies, which are widely used in search engine technology and in the development of electronic dictionaries and online training programmes. The compilation of a subject-specific terminological dictionary could therefore be a way of resolving the dichotomy between definition and ideography as part of the process of producing a subject-specific terminological dictionary.

2.6. The question of integrating individual subject-specific
terminological systems
Interaction between individual subject-specific terminological systems has recently
been the focus of a great deal of debate, including in relation to issues of the development and operation of integrated terminological systems.
The terminological sets found within integrated terminological systems can be
identified by the following specific characteristics:
1) a significant and specific weight is given to lexis within the word set that makes
up the terminological system;
2) the terms come from a variety of sources;
3) large parts of one terminological system is included in another;
4) terminological units from other terminological systems are present, as well as
related concepts relevant to the research disciplines that cross over within the integrated set.
In the field of animal anatomy, an integrated terminological system could be
exemplified through defining the anatomical structure of the pelvis. Traditionally, three disciplines have had a professional interest in this part of the anatomy: anatomists, emergency specialists and birth and delivery specialists. Each uses a different set of principles as the basis for their classification of the structure of the pelvis. For animal anatomists, a logical basis for classification could be that of bilateral symmetry, in which the body of an animal is divided into two halves (right and left). In veterinary emergency medicine, an equally logical basis for classification might, in addition to an anatomical approach, be with reference to the parameters of clinical veterinary medicine, and focussed on the fact that the pelvis is jractured. This highlights the parts of the pelvis that have been damaged - its edge. Birth and delivery specialists, however, would be likely to approach the issue of naming different parts of the pelvis on the basis of how far the size of the pelvis minor, which is involved in the process of giving birth, is within or outside the normal size range. Using the example of these three disciplines and their approach to the classification of a single anatomical element, a five-fold model may be posited in the designation of a single object (two within anatomy, two in emergency medicine, and one in birth and delivery). The general approach uses a logical method of dividing up the anatomical object in question, and is based on the principle of listing the constituent parts of a given element. Analysis reveals that each of the three areas displays its own specificities. Taken together, they allow us to identify the following peculiarities in each of the terminologies under consideration. The terminology used by the anatomists stresses the normal structure of the skeleton
and can generally be characterised within the categories object; space; process. These categories are to be found in the approach used by emergency medicine specialists, although the category of object includes the characteristic part of a whole, which tends to indicate an aspect of trauma. Birth and delivery specialists appear to be the most detailed of the three disciplines. They use the categories disease; gender; time. Perhaps the most interesting aspect of this conceptual cluster is the process category. This detailed analysis of the terminological set used to classify anatomical elements found in the three disciplines of anatomy, emergency medicine and birth and delivery reveals that the anatomical list derived here accords with the International Anatomical Terminology and provides example of Latin-based terms, together with their Russian and Kazakh equivalents. These are present in between two and three terminological sets, which characterise the structure of the pelvis (eg: acetabular fossa; acetabular floor; iliac tuberosity), including all its sub-structures, size ranges and conceptual characteristics.
The terms contained in the Anatomical Atlas tend to follow closely the contours of
the terms and their synonyms found in the International Anatomical Terminology: pelvic bones/pelvic ring; bone joint; sacrococcygeal articulation. The generalised interdisciplinary terminology within veterinary medicine discussed here encompasses a number of sub-disciplines (anatomy, emergency medicine and birth and delivery). The approach of each takes account of a variety of theoretical and pragmatic objectives within each of the professional sub-groups. This demonstrates how much the same physical object can appear differently in the minds of different specialists, evidenced by the different terms each group has derived and uses. This provides a basis for the compilation of a series of terms united by the fact that they are derived from a single parent-term, pelvis.
Terminology used by veterinary birth and delivery specialists is also highly
practical in character. Anatomists tend to designate the anatomical element we know as the pelvis with one term (pelvis). Birth specialists break the pelvis down at a more detailed level. Diagnoses made by these specialists, which mention the pelvis use both terms and specialised professional language. These break down into categories such as form, size and the pathology of any abnormalities in the area (eg: small; narrow, uniformly tapered, clinically narrow pelvis). Size is relevant as a characteristic of the pelvis, given its bearing on the ability of female animals to give birth.
In addition to the veterinary medical terms anatomically narrow pelvis and clinically
narrow pelvis, the phrase functionally narrow pelvis is also used in professional jargon: this has a generalising effect that covers the meanings of both previous terms. Occasionally, diagnoses include the generalised, profession-specific term dimensions of the pelvis, which gives rise to a number of definitions of a particular form of pelvic narrowing (eg: generalised, uniform narrowing; flattened narrowing, transverse narrowing etc). In addition to these
generalised groupings, a further group of terms exists to allow the concept of narrowing to be specified in more detail with reference to the reason for the narrowing (eg:
narrowed pelvis due to exotosis).
Birth and delivery terminology tends to focus on deviations from the norm in terms
of the dimensions of the pelvis (eg: obliquely dislocated pelvis; flattened, rachitic pelvis, scoliotic pelvis). These terms all express, in various ways, the opposite to the concept of a 'normal situation'. Even though the concept of normality is not explicitly defined, the words normal pelvis can be observed in discourse between birth and delivery specialists as a unit of professional jargon.
Certain items of vocabulary within professional veterinary medicine are not terms. For example: section of the edge of the pelvic bone; trochanter recess wall, section of the pelvic bone, egress from the small pelvis etc). These could be considered as 'pre-terms' which may, in time, take on the full status of a term.
The number of terms which designate the same object has, in this case, increased by
about one and a half times. Of those terminologies that have been analysed semantically, the most commonly occurring phenomenon is synonymy (34% of the overall number of terms) and figurative usage (44%). Terminology within veterinary anatomy is calibrated, precise and in line with international norms. As a result, it displays lower levels of synonymy. Synonymy is present to a greater degree within birth and delivery disciplines (eg: obliquely dislocated pelvis; scoliotic pelvis; asymmetrically narrowed pelvis). The introduction of veterinary anatomical terminology into veterinary emergency medicine has also given rise to synonymy: lobkovaia kost/lonnaia kost [pubis]; kresttsovo-kopchikoviy sustav/kresttsovo-kopchikoviy soedinenie [sacrococcygeal joint].
These examples show that the use of terminology from animal anatomy to describe
an item of anatomy does not always allow the correct degree of precision needed for professionals to communicate between themselves. Supplementary information is sometimes required to define exactly what is meant in professional discourse among specialists and teachers in the clinical disciplines of veterinary medicine. The integration of knowledge from two or more disciplines into one area of contemporary research, business or social endeavour can lead to the formation of integrated sets of terminology. In this case, the terms in the new subject area will be binominal, and will naturally combine terms from one subject area with those of another. This is the case in land economy, which combines terms from economics and veterinary medicine (eg: business-related activities within a system of fee-paying veterinary services). Such terms can be borrowed from a mixture of different knowledge areas. They operate on two different bases: they can either be used as part of the original terminological system from which they were borrowed, or as an integral part of the new terminological system into which they were transferred.
Terminology actively uses methods found in semiology. This is because terms can be considered as conceptual signs, and terminological systems are
Q1
therefore systems composed of signs. Terms are to be found in situations where semiotic research can be applied, including syntax, semantics and pragmatics (P.G.Piotrovskii; S.V.Grinev). The theory of terminology also has strong links with some mathematical disciplines, such as mathematical linguistic methodology and set theory. Both are used to study terminological systems, individual terms and the processes by which these systems operate.
Veterinary medical terminology and its terminological subsets have been used for
cluster analysis in various research projects including terminological research into fixation. They have appeared in documentation such as dictionaries, documents of the World Health Organisation and collections of recommended standard terminology from the World Organisation for Animal Health. A number of theoretical and applied terminology research products have resulted from cluster analysis, such as descriptions of various fields of knowledge and base material for the compilation of terminological dictionaries.
The range of interdisciplinary research areas, methods and terminologies is
extensive. It includes all disciplines, which work with Russian- and Kazakh-language information systems, including areas such as methodological and terminological work into engineering psychology. The naming of new objects identified during research is done by researchers themselves on the basis of either an intuitive grasp or conscious knowledge of the principles of terminological designation. It is partly dependent on the heuristic and linguistic capabilities of the individual researcher, and can also touch on the individual's creative talents (eg: fibrous muscular bundle; Eustachian tube; genetic
memory).
Terminological standardisation uses the generalised principles of the theory of
standardisation (unification). It focuses on the standardisation of terms within particular subject areas. The result of interdisciplinary work has been to establish terminological standards at international, national and subject-specific levels. These standards are successfully used in research-based and technological areas of work in a variety of fields of knowledge.
3. The functional and motivational nature of specialised terminology
1. The nominative, definitive, communicative and heuristic
fUnctions of Russian and Kazakh terms
When we talk about the function of a group of terms, we are referring to the role of terms as a means of signifying a specialised concept common to a number of fields: the lexico-semantic system of 'natural language' as a linguistic substratum; the terminology of a specialised field of knowledge; the theory behind that specialised field. Terms are multifunctional and their functions are interconnected. Given that terms are based on lexical items, the functions of terms (nominative, significative, communicative, pragmatic, etc.) are based on the functions of words. Across the various fields, the functions of terms are diverse and interconnected. Terms are multifunctional, and all of their functions must be studied in relation to one another.
The nominative function denotes the representational aspect of a term. Like all lexical items, terms have a nominative function. According to the theory of nomination, in the process of reality perception and collaboration between people certain objects must be named, along with their attributes and functions. The functional value displays certain similarities with the identifying value. Like identifying nominations, terms are also characterised by high levels of taxonomy, continuous borders of reference, conditioned by the realia of the external world. Only the functional type of a term with a nominative value can be defined in terms of the dual values of identification + the idea of the entire prior signification of the named object. The nomination of a term with its own functional value objectifies distinct concepts, formed on the basis of sensory perception. It is active contemplation of the object that forms an imprint on the characteristics of the linguistic stylisation of the object. Provided the object is perceived as monofunctional, one may assume that the nominative unit (the term) that objectifies that object will belong to the category monosemantic. The main focus here will be the diverse terminological systems whose constituent lexical items act as synonyms in comparable languages, not only at the denotative but also at the significative level.
Stemming directly from the practical life of a society, the nomination of terms with their own functional value can show us the ethnographic and culturological characteristics of linguistic communities. Any discrepancies in this area will tend to be found in the semantic category of nonequivalent vocabulary. Ethnographic terms occupy a prominent position in this category.
